Output 68f23dccdcf1d10ac4c960caf997f23f0f3bd386125dcd17bced1aff486efe8f:21

value
666539
script pubkey
OP_0 OP_PUSHBYTES_20 569a64055ba9be74edbd7a4006108441b80bada0
address
bc1q26dxgp2m4xl8fmda0fqqvyyygxuqhtdqpypnhr
transaction
68f23dccdcf1d10ac4c960caf997f23f0f3bd386125dcd17bced1aff486efe8f
confirmations
119373
spent
true